I know I’ve been a very bad girl. I’ve been offline for a while, but it was a needed thing. Yes, my sanity was in jepardy. I finished my book, and read about 4 others, and am just putting together a proposal for my next one…and I’ve gone back to work full time.

Part of it is because it’s May and everyone else went on holidays and in return for being able to take time off here , there and anywhere so I can meet deadlines and go to confrences is that I work when everyone else goes on holidays. The other part is me needing to “refill the well”.

Yep. I’ve decided, I have one more book contracted, and I’m not sending out any proposals for more until I find an idea I’m really excited about. I’m not saying I’m not going to write anymore. I will. But I do think I need to refocus on finding stories *I* feel a connection with, and not just ones that I know will sell. Part of that is simply finding my passion for writing again. And finding my passion for writing will come from finding my passion for life again. It’s hard to write about life when I’m not living it. Now, don’t think that means I lie, or do , everything my characters do, but I do feel that one of my strengths as an author is writing characters that are real….and to me, thats because I spend time with real people. And being single, and living alone, and writing, has kept me from that for a while.

My own bad, I tend to be very obsessive in whatever I do, and my friends have tried to get me to go out, but I’ve become a hermit. So, for a while. I’m going ot keep writing, but not at the expense of living a more well-rounded life.

I can’t remember who’s blog I saw this on, but someome was posting the 1 Star reviews of thier books, and since I’d started the “Readers Speak” thing a while ago, I figured Hey, why not. My books get great reviews, and I Love it. But to be fair, there are sometimes ones that make me go “whoa.”

So, here are my 1 star reviews from Amazon.

For WICKED:

“I was really excited to purchase this book from all its raved reviews. Only to be dissapointed with it once i recieved it. I mean at first i thought it was going be a quite steamy book with its prologue. But into the first chapter…just terrible. It really felt like someone carelessly, inexpreincely written it. The beginning was filled with too many repeats. With the character repeating lines from the other with expressing their mental thoughts. The female main character said ‘oh, yeah’ or ‘oh,yes’ so many times i wanted to shred the book. It wasn’t humourous, the dialogue wasnt smooth but choppy. There weren’t enough fluff or flow to the story and then to have meaningless scenes in the story just to tie us with characters from previous books or a hint of another. i thought she could’ve done a better job with the story line, i was hoping for more substance. And it end up being predictable and unoriginal… It had good ideas, like the scene were the main characters take a shower together, the meaning of the scene anyways…but White’s erotic scenes would either be done short and poorly or laid out and not enough detail. Save yourself the trouble, DONT waste your money on this one. Do buy Broken from Megan Hart, she written an absolutely tremediously heartwarming tale…”

No, I did not mess with the review. It was copied and pasted exactly as it was on Amazon, spelling errors, typos, and refrences to other authors as they were. And I actually have to Thank this reviewer, because of this review Megan Hart and I had a good starting point to chat about when we met in New York, and I now consider her a good friend. The woman rocks!

FOR TROUBLE:

Kelly said: I am an avid reader of erotic books, but for me to find one enjoyable, I prefer a good story along with the steamy sex. This book had no story to speak of, but what was worse, the characters were awful, and not developed. I didn’t care if they were together or not. Believe it or not the writing was worse than everything I mentioned above. The sex scenes were forced between two characters we cared nothing about. I only got in the first 100 pages, as that was all I could stomach. Spend your hard earned cash on something else.

J.Freedman Said:
“Am I the only person who couldn’t take this book seriously? I’m all for erotica books that have hot sex scenes and not much plot or character development to speak of (after all, who reads erotica for a plot?)… but this was just ridiculous. I can’t take this book seriously because the writing is just so cheesy and awful.”

Ouch! After many great reviews, those 2 One Star ones for Trouble were posted within a week of each other, just recently. But…There were no one star reviews for BOUND, and I’ll do the kensington books another day. I have to admit, I checked on SEXY DEVIL today though, and there were no one star reviews there either.

And too make it even more apparent that reading, and reviews, are all subjective, I figured nows a good time to announce that TROUBLE is a finalist in the MORE THAN MAGIC contest. A Reader Judged contest.
